SUMMARY

Responsible for assisting with the quality‑efficient and cost‑effective management of the school kitchen. In conjunction with or in the absence of the kitchen manager, perform and oversee all aspects of food preparation and service of meals, including scheduling, directing, training, and supervising child nutrition workers. Maintain and review all kitchen financial records and reports, order, receive, store, rotate, and inventory all food and supplies, prepare and serve full‑range meals, and assist with production and service operations.

JOB TASKS
  • Assist the kitchen manager in supervising, directing, and training kitchen staff; support meal preparation by cooking, pre‑portioning, setting up serving lines, condiment stands, and fruit and vegetable bar; prepare food items according to recipes and menus; control food and kitchen waste; maintain accurate daily production records.
  • Clean kitchen equipment, utensils, work areas, tables, floors, and appliances; properly maintain equipment; empty trash and recycling containers; sweep and mop floors.
  • Serve food and provide customer service and communication to students, staff, and the community.
  • Operate the point‑of‑sale system: prepare and process payments, create day‑end reports, deposit money, verify correct change in the cash box, enroll customers with finger scanning as required, and close out sites daily.
  • Assist with ordering, receiving, storing, and rotating food and supplies to maintain inventory control; properly receive, check‑in, and store food and equipment from vendors; maintain, date, and label food for storage; perform inventories and assist the manager with orders.
  • Maintain and review all kitchen financial records, deposits, meal counts and change funds; verify accuracy daily.
  • Ensure compliance with Health Department standards, sanitation, safety procedures, departmental policies, and state and federal regulations.
  • Provide relief to the kitchen manager as needed; offer positive leadership to ensure teamwork and compliance with guidelines.
  • Communicate, coordinate, and resolve issues with principal, school staff, parents, and supervisors; maintain excellent customer service, accurate signage, marketing, and food presentation.
  • Attend all required departmental trainings.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E, AND LICENSES REQUIRED
  • High school diploma or G.E.D.
  • Previous institutional food service experience preferred.
  • Equivalent combination of education and experience acceptable.
  • Criminal background check required for hire.
  • ServSafe certification required.
